(AP) — Nike has suspended its relationship with Kyrie Irving and canceled its designs to launch his up coming signature shoe, the most up-to-date chapter in the ongoing fallout considering that the Brooklyn Nets guard tweeted a url to a movie that contains antisemitic product.
The shoe large declared Friday night time that it will halt its romance with Irving, who has been suspended by the Nets for what the group named a repeated failure to “unequivocally say he has no antisemitic beliefs.”
The Nets built that transfer Thursday, banning Irving with out shell out for at minimum 5 games, and a working day later on, Nike manufactured its decision. Those actions followed popular criticism — from, among the a lot of some others, the Anti-Defamation League and NBA Commissioner Adam Silver.
“At Nike, we believe there is no position for hate speech and we condemn any sort of antisemitism,” the Beaverton, Oregon-dependent business stated. “To that conclusion, we have built the final decision to suspend our relationship with Kyrie Irving helpful quickly and will no more time launch the Kyrie 8.”
Irving has had a signature line with Nike considering the fact that 2014.
“We are deeply saddened and disappointed by the problem and its effects on all people,” Nike reported.
Irving signed with Nike in 2011, shortly immediately after getting to be the No. 1 select in that year’s NBA draft. Irving’s 1st signature shoe was released three years later, and the recognition of the Kyrie line led to him earning a noted $11 million per year just from the Nike endorsement.
The Kyrie 8 was predicted to be launched in the next 7 days. Preceding versions of his shoes had been even now for sale on the Nike internet site Friday night.
Irving posted a tweet — which has considering that been deleted — final week with a link to the documentary “Hebrews to Negroes: Wake Up Black The usa,” which involves Holocaust denial and conspiracy theories about Jews. In a contentious postgame interview session previous Saturday, Irving defended his ideal to post what he would like.
The fallout only ongoing from there. The NBA set out a assertion in excess of the weekend that didn’t title Irving but denounced all varieties of detest speech. Lovers donning “Fight Antisemitism” shirts occupied some courtside seats at the Brooklyn-Indiana activity on Monday evening, a day following he took down the tweet. The Nets and mentor Steve Nash parted means Tuesday, a advancement that has been overshadowed by the Irving saga.
On Wednesday, Irving mentioned he opposes all varieties of loathe, and he and the Nets just about every introduced that they would every single donate $500,000 toward groups that perform to eradicate it. Silver then issued a new assertion calling on Irving by name to apologize, and Irving refused to give a direct reply when questioned Thursday if he has antisemitic beliefs.
That, evidently, was the final straw for the Nets, who suspended him. Several hours afterwards, Irving posted an apology on Instagram for not conveying the specific beliefs he agreed and disagreed with when he posted the documentary.
“To All Jewish family members and Communities that are harm and affected from my put up, I am deeply sorry to have caused you soreness, and I apologize,” Irving wrote. “I initially reacted out of emotion to becoming unjustly labeled Anti-Semitic, rather of focusing on the therapeutic system of my Jewish Brothers and Sisters that were damage from the hateful remarks produced in the Documentary.”
A working day afterwards, Nike — which had also been criticized for not shifting more swiftly — took motion.
Irving becomes the second celebrity in a lot less than two months to shed a major shoe offer in excess of antisemitism. Adidas parted ways with Ye — the artist formerly recognised as Kanye West — late previous thirty day period, a go the German enterprise stated would result in about $250 million in losses this yr just after stopping manufacturing of its line of Yeezy products and solutions as perfectly as halting payments to Ye and his providers.
For weeks, Ye made antisemitic remarks in interviews and on social media, which includes a Twitter write-up that he would soon go “death con 3 on JEWISH Individuals,” an apparent reference to the U.S. defense readiness problem scale acknowledged as DEFCON.
Irving has expressed no shortage of controversial opinions through his career. He continuously questioned whether the Earth was spherical prior to eventually apologizing to science lecturers. Very last 12 months, his refusal to get a COVID-19 vaccine led to him currently being banned from playing in most of the Nets’ property game titles.
